昔日期货龙头业绩掉队,永安期货去年营收净利双降,一季度净利暴跌88%
Di Yi Cai Jing· 2025-04-25 12:27
Core Viewpoint - The competition landscape in the futures industry is increasingly showing signs of differentiation, with some companies thriving while others, like Yong'an Futures, are experiencing significant declines in performance [1][4]. Group 1: Company Performance - Yong'an Futures, once the industry leader, reported a revenue of 21.73 billion yuan in 2024, a decrease of 8.76% year-on-year, and a net profit of 575 million yuan, down 21.07% [2][3]. - In contrast, Nanhua Futures achieved a revenue of 5.71 billion yuan in 2024, a decline of 8.56%, but its net profit increased by 13.96% to 457 million yuan [2]. - Both Ruida Futures and Hongye Futures saw growth in revenue and net profit, with Ruida Futures' revenue increasing by 95% and Hongye Futures' net profit surging by 282% [2][3]. Group 2: Industry Trends - The futures industry is undergoing a transformation, facing pressure to shift from a reliance on commission-based competition to a more diversified and differentiated approach [1][4]. - The overall net profit for the futures industry in 2024 was 9.471 billion yuan, a decline of 4.1% year-on-year, marking the third consecutive year of profit decrease [4][5]. - The industry is exploring structural growth through innovative segments such as risk management, asset management, and overseas business, with companies like Nanhua Futures and Hongye Futures successfully increasing their revenue from these areas [5]. Group 3: Future Outlook - The trend of consolidation towards leading firms in the futures industry is expected to continue, with companies that have strong capital, international presence, and diversified business models likely to emerge as winners [5]. - Smaller firms are encouraged to seek survival through specialized services as the competitive landscape evolves [5].

永安期货(600927):整体业绩承压,回购提振信心
HTSC· 2025-04-24 09:30
Investment Rating - The investment rating for the company is maintained at "Buy" with a target price of RMB 15.38 [8][9]. Core Insights - The company reported a revenue of RMB 21.735 billion for 2024, a year-on-year decrease of 8.76%, and a net profit attributable to shareholders of RMB 575 million, down 21.07% year-on-year [1]. - In Q1 2025, the company achieved a revenue of RMB 2.277 billion, a significant decline of 47.51% year-on-year, with a net profit of RMB 9 million, down 88.08% year-on-year, primarily due to the drag from investment business [1]. - The company plans to repurchase shares worth RMB 50 million to RMB 100 million to boost investor confidence [1]. Revenue Breakdown - The company's commission and fee income for 2024 was RMB 538 million, down 28.9% year-on-year, with domestic futures trading volume decreasing by 14.1% [2]. - The risk management business generated revenue of RMB 20.142 billion in 2024, a decrease of 9.8% year-on-year, while the company maintained its leading position in the market [3]. - The overseas financial services business saw a revenue increase of 51.06% year-on-year, reaching RMB 430 million in 2024 [4]. Profit Forecast and Valuation - The company has adjusted its earnings per share (EPS) forecasts for 2025-2027 to RMB 0.29, RMB 0.34, and RMB 0.38, respectively, reflecting a downward revision of 37% and 35% for 2025 and 2026 [5]. - The book value per share (BPS) for 2025 is projected at RMB 9.05, down 2% from previous estimates [5]. - The target price of RMB 15.38 corresponds to a price-to-book (PB) ratio of 1.7 times for 2025, reflecting a discount due to operational pressures [5].
